| Sergei
Mitrokhin: “The democratic project of the country’s
development is closed”
Press Release, November 30,
2009
On Saturday, November 29, 2009, a
meeting of YABLOKO’s Bureau took place in Moscow.
The Bureau adopted decisions on working over persuading
the government not to abolish indexation of unemployment
benefits, return gratuitous public transport tickets
for pensioners of the Moscow Region and creation of
nature reserve Utrish. The Bureau also heard the reports
of the Human Rights and the Gender factions of the
party.
The meeting was opened by party Chair
Sergei Mitrokhin who made a report on the political
situation in Russia. “It has become clear after
voting on October 11 that elections as a legitimate
institution that could be trusted by the society is
completely ruined in Russia. This means that the democratic
project of the country’s development initiated
in the late 1980s has been completely closed now –
and not only by the ruling elite, but by the society
as well,” Mitrokhin said. According to Mitrokhin,
the forthcoming YABLOKO’s congress (that will
take place in December 2009) has to formulate the
basis of a new democratic project for Russia.

YABLOKO
criticizes Economic Minister Elvira Nabiullina
Press Release May 15, 2009
YABLOKO’s leader Sergei Mitrokhin
expressed protest in connection with the plans of
the Economic Ministry to raise gas prices by 15 per
cent for companies and by 5 per cent for the population. |
Will
Monopolies’ Tariffs Be Transparent?
Press Release, May 12, 2009
Sergei Mitrokhin, the leader of the
YABLOKO party and the Yabloko faction in the Moscow
City Duma, submitted for examination of the Moscow
City Duma a draft law obliging natural monopolies
and companies on budget funding applying regulated
tariffs and extra charges to disclose and publish
in the Internet their financial information. |
